Sassafras Jelly
A canning/preserving recipe for Sassafras roots.
AmericanChickenEasy30 minBy Northstar
Ingredients
Servings
4
- 1 package powdered pectin
- 3 cups honey
- 2 tablespoons sassafras root bark
Instructions
- 1
Boil sassafras roots for 30 minutes, then strain.
- 2
Measure 2 cups of the sassafras tea into a large saucepan. Add pectin and just barely bring to a boil.
- 3
Add honey and sassafras root bark. that has been grated to a fine powder. Simmer for 6 minutes.
- 4
Put into sterilized glasses. For pints, process in a boiling water bath for 10 minutes. For half−pints, process in a boiling water bath for 5 minutes.
